Carrier Grade Linux has been enjoyed by many telecom carrier man- ufacturers due to its inexpensiveness,open code, independent platform and rapid upgrade. Clinux is a developing Carrier Grade Linux in HuaWei Inc. Driver hardening is a necessary part in Clinux because it highly requires availability of device.This paper emphasizes on traditional driver hardening technique in Linux, and improves on it for CLinux requirement. It aims at making three major contributions:Firstly, based on the project background, this paper analyzes the architecture of Carrier Grade Linux, emphatically introduces traditional driver hardening technique and analyzes its shortcoming.Secondly, the paper designs and implements CLinux's driver hardening, which perfects traditional driver hardening technique.Thirdly, based on CLinux's driver hardening architecture, this paper researchs CLinux's fault handling. This paper designs and implements a fault injection method for simulating device fault and performs some fault injection experiments of E100 Pro 100/+ network card. From these expe- riments, we obtain fault data and apply data mining method to analyze these data. From analysis, this paper draws some conclusions, which are in favor of improving network card's availability. In addition, this paper designs an algorithm for improving efficiency of fault recovery and verifies its significance by two fault injection experiments.The work and contribution of this paper are important part of Clinux and have realistic significance to the research and implementation of Carrier Grade Linux, and have considerable referential values to related research.
